The purpose of this article is to provide information about learning that adheres to the theory of constructivism through the active, creative, effective, and fun learning model (PAKEM) in volleyball game material in grade VII Junior High School. Constructivism learning theory provides opportunities for students to build their own conceptual knowledge through teacher facilitation. Physical education, sports, and health (PESH) learning activities involve moving activities to achieve competence. The volleyball game is one of the materials used in learning PESH movements. The principle of learning PESH is to involve students to be active and enjoy when doing physical activities. The PAKEM model is an alternative that can be used in volleyball learning for seventh grade students of junior high school. The PAKEM model helps students build their own knowledge through the variety of lessons the teacher provides. In conclusion with the PAKEM model students can be active, creative, effective, and happy while learning volleyball in PESH is presented. Teachers need to innovate continuously to design learning models that are appropriate to the characteristics of students.Keywords:constructivism learning theory, PAKEM, physical education, volleyball  AbstrakTujuan dari artikel ini adalah memberikan informasi tentang pembelajaran yang menganut teori konstruktivisme melalui model pembelajaran aktif, kreatif, efektif, dan menyenangkan (PAKEM) dalam materi permainan bolavoli pada kelas VII Sekolah Menengah Pertama. This article aims to provide information about learning based on behaviorism learning theory through a drill learning model in football game material in grade VII Junior High School. Behaviorism learning theory, which has the principle of providing a stimulus that results in a response. The stimulus is given by the teacher in the form of material that needs to be done by students, resulting in students responding by doing assignments from the material. Physical education, sports, and health (PESH) learning activities involve moving activities to achieve competence. The game of football is one of the materials used in learning PESH movements. The principle of learning PESH is to involve students to move happily. The drill learning model is an alternative that can be used in soccer learning for seventh-grade students of junior high school. The exercise learning model is repeating movements in sports techniques that have been compiled by the teacher. In conclusion, with a variety of exercise learning models, students can learn PESH material to achieve better and more active sports movements and feel happy. Teachers need to innovate continuously to design learning models that are following the characteristics of students.

The incorporation of music in the physical education (PE) environment during physical activity has been shown to be beneficial for participants. Karageorghis et al. (1999) created a conceptual framework focusing on asynchronous music, identifying four factors important to a given piece of music: rhythm response, musicality, cultural impact, and association. The purpose of this study was to investigate the effect of two conditions, with and without the incorporation of music, in the PE environment on student moods in 948 junior high school students (501 males, 447 females). The conditions were measured using the Profile of Mood States (POMS) Short Form. Significant differences were observed in the mean scores of POMS between preintervention (without music) and postintervention (with music) for total mood disturbance, tension, anger, fatigue, depression, and confusion (all p values < 0.0001), as well as significantly higher mean scores for esteem-related affect and vigor (p values < 0.0001). Results from this study, and others, provide an impetus for PE teachers and PE teacher education to incorporate music during games/activities for the purpose of improving student moods and subsequent activity levels.

Research Highlights The study proposed two focus studies and results indicated there is a conformity between Brain Based Learning (BBL) and students' intrapersonal intelligence toward characteristics of junior high school mathematics learning. Implementation of Brain Based Learning (BBL) and intrapersonal intelligence in junior high school mathematics learning can improve student’s learning outcomes.   Research Objectives This research aims to knowing activities of junior high school mathematics learning and to knowing conformity of characteristics between Brain Based Learning (BBL) and intrapersonal intelligence with junior high school mathematics learning. BBL as a learning strategies and intrapersonal intelligence as an internal factors of students must be the main consideration in learning activities, including in this case mathematics learning. Learning is more directed at construction than instruction, which has implications for the role of teachers and students (Reigeluth and Carr-Chellman, 2009). Learning strategies concept is a various types of plans used by the teacher to achieve goals (Silver et al., 2012). In simple terms, this view states that learning strategies are ways to do something in achieving goals. Learning mathematics is learning about the concepts and structure of mathematics and looking for relationships between the two on the material being studied (Bruner, 2009). In the learning activities, learning materials must be adapted to the abilities and cognitive structures of students. Learning material must be related to the concepts that are already owned so that new ideas can be fully absorbed by students (Ausubel, 2012). Learning activities must be gradual, sequential and always based on past learning experiences.   Methodology This type of research is qualitative descriptive. The approach used is qualitative with descriptive methods and literature studies. Data collection uses documentation studies, observations, and interviews with teachers and students. Data collection was conducted in junior high school of SMP Assahil Lampung Timur in the 2018/2019 academic year. The mathematics teachers and students were included in this study as a respondents. In this study the data analysis used was quantitative descriptive and qualitative descriptive analysis. Quantitative descriptive analysis is used to present and analyze data relating to mathematics learning outcomes over the past three years. Qualitative descriptive analysis is used to interpret and analyze data regarding the learning process of mathematics that has taken place.   Results The study indicate that mathematics teachers have only used expository learning strategies in learning activities. The expository learning strategy is a form of teacher-centered learning approach. Mathematical learning outcomes are not satisfactory. The Mathematics learning is a learning process that involves active students building mathematical knowledge (Cobb, 2013). In mathematics learning there is a process of developing students' creativity to improve their abilities and beliefs in building knowledge and mastering good mathematics subject matter. The Characteristics of Brain Based Learning (BBL) emphasizes students to play an active role in building the concepts learned (Ulger, 2018). The steps in the BBL learning strategy include creating a learning environment that challenges students' thinking skills (regulated immersion), creates a relaxed learning environment, and creates actual and meaningful learning situations for students (active processing). Intrapersonal intelligence is self-knowledge as intelligence that involves self-awareness or self-sensitivity, thought processes, realizing changes that occur in oneself, involving skills of cooperation and communication both verbally and nonverbally (Alder, 2001). The characteristics of intrapersonal intelligence consist of three main aspects that can be used as benchmarks, namely recognizing oneself, knowing one's own desires, and knowing what is necessary for oneself.   Findings The results of data analysis, it was found that the learning activities that had taken place so far only used expository learning strategies. The teacher does not apply learning strategies that are in accordance with the internal factors of students in learning mathematics. The literature review show that there is a match between the characteristics of junior high school mathematics material, the characteristics of BBL learning strategies and the characteristics of intrapersonal intelligence. Therefore, the implementation of BBL learning strategies and intrapersonal intelligence in junior high school mathematics learning is very well done to improve student learning outcomes.   Acknowledgement This study was supported by Universitas Negeri Jakarta and SMP Assahil Lampung Timur, for which thanks to 1) Doctoral Program in Educational Technology, Postgraduate Program at Universitas Negeri Jakarta; 2) SMP Assahil Lampung Timur; 3) Prof. Dr. M. Abstract: The purpose of this class action research is to improve the learning outcomes of under passing the volleyball students of class VIII-D State Junior High School 15 Malang using the play approach. Based on the results of preliminary observations obtained learning outcomes of students when the practice of the basic technique of under passing volleyball at a lesser level. Then learning using the play approach for two cycles and learning outcomes using the play approach at the end of the second cycle obtained the percentage results with the level of truth that is 23 or 76.67% good category, body position 24 or 80% good category, 23 arm position or 76.67% good category, the direction and direction of the ball 24 or 80% good category. Based on the results of the percentage it can be said that through the play approach can improve the learning outcomes of basic techniques of under passing the volleyball of students of class VIII-D State Junior High School 15 Malang. Keywords: learning outcomes, under passing of volleyball, physical education, playing approaches. Abstrak: Tujuan dari penelitian tindakan kelas ini adalah untuk meningkatkan hasil belajar passing bawah bolavoli siswa kelas VIII-D SMP Negeri 15 Malang dengan menggunakan pendekatan bermain. This study aims to analyse textbooks used by students based on the scientific approach as the realization of learning objectives using the 2013 curriculum. This study did several things: first, an investigation of the teaching materials used by students based on the scientific approach, second studied the suitability of the content of textbooks used by students with the syllabus in the 2013 curriculum, thirdly investigating the contribution of textbooks used to higher-order thinking skills. Research method used is mixed methods namely descriptive method and survey study at Islamic Junior High School in Medan. There are 3 textbooks that will be analysed, the textbooks from three different publishers which used by the school. The total number of students who participated in this study were 201 students. Where students who participated in the study were selected based on purposive random sampling through certain considerations, the students come from Islamic Junior High School An Nizam, Islamic Junior High School Ulun Nuha, and Islamic Junior High School Al Fityan, the condition and character of schools are almost same, so is expected the homogeneous sample. The results obtained are: (1) From the three books, the results of conformity assessment with the syllabus in book A are 65%, book B is 80%, and book C 40%; (2) The evaluation results of the textbooks by using the scientific steps find that book A obtained a score of 53 in the low category, book B got a score of 58 in the low category, and book C got a score of 55 also in the low category; 3) The results of the assessment of HOTS ability of students from each school that use books A, B, and C are on the average low category.
